What Is Lancaster County Heritage?

 
 
{quilt}   
 
  
It’s a countywide network of Heritage Resources-- natural, cultural, and historic resources -- that are officially designated by the Lancaster County Planning Commission (LCPC).
 
Initiated in 1994 with assistance from the National Trust for Historic Preservation,the program is now administered by LCPC staff with the involvement of local residents who serve on the program’s Advisory Council.

Across the Susquehanna River, Lancaster County Heritage has a parallel program called York County Heritage.  Both programs work cooperatively with the Susquehanna Gateway Heritage Area to interpret and promote heritage resources in the two-county region.
